Output 62afc52aa63e1e1a6ae7adaaf52e3d31433cfd420921bf327ec2f946e17d2c3d:1

value
854504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5abfb5904f5e2b560cf5246ef20680905ff660 OP_EQUAL
address
37C9BPsiXpLph8ahp4xXCNdbk5UNUqEJXa
transaction
62afc52aa63e1e1a6ae7adaaf52e3d31433cfd420921bf327ec2f946e17d2c3d
spent
true